418 open burning cases detected amid dry spell, more expected

This article is 3 years old

Cases of open burning are on the rise once again amid a dry spell caused by the Southwest Monsoon season, said the Department of Environment (DOE).

The department said it has detected 418 such cases so far this month, up to July 22.
